Nu Holdings (NU) trades at $13.84, down 1.98% with a bearish technical outlook. The company shows strong fundamental growth with revenue increasing from $3.0B in 2022 to $10.6B in 2025 and net income turning positive to $2.9B. Recent earnings show mixed results with two misses but a beat in Q3 2025. Analyst consensus remains bullish with a $14.98 price target despite recent price weakness.
Nu presents a compelling growth story with expanding profitability and market position in Latin American banking. Key risks include unsecured credit exposure and regional economic volatility. The current valuation at 21.35 P/E offers potential upside if the company maintains its growth trajectory and executes on expansion plans in Brazil and Mexico.

Enveric Biosciences is a biotechnology company focused on developing next-generation psychedelic-inspired therapies for mental health and neuropsychiatric disorders.
